Transaction

e4044d511279ff1d6f4d545cfd313b070e2b85cdf1a6a972c048bc71d6d4dec0
433,635 confirmations
Timestamp
1516599619
Block505,478
Fee62,984 sats
Fee rate281.2 sats/vB
view on mempool.space

Inputs & Outputs